A BIG STEAL.

A BANK TELLER ARRESTED. By Electric Telegraph—Per Press Association)—Copyright/. *• Received 9 80 a.m., April 21. Melbourne, April 20. In connection with the mysterious re-, moval of £2OOO from the Bendigo branch' of the Bank of Australasia some time ago, five criminal summonses have been served upon Grey, the teller, charging him with embezzlement aud falsification of the
